WebMany students, hearing and D/deaf, are limited in their use of comprehension and metacognitive strategies (Banner & Wang, 2011; Donne & Rugg, 2015; Morrison et al., … WebApr 12, 2024 · This article will tell you how to implement the four parts of explicit instruction into your classroom. 1. Model with clear explanations. How: Explain or show the skill in the same way learners will practice it. Focus on the critical parts of the content you are teaching. Why: When expectations are clear, it takes out the guesswork from learning.
